node expert Fundamentals Explained

set up: To get rolling with Nodemailer, you'll want to set up it as a dependency within your Node.js venture. open up your terminal and navigate in your project directory, then run the subsequent command:

three. community development server. NodemailerApp is usually configured as an SMTP relay server in the development surroundings. e-mail sent from community environments (like Laravel) can be immediately previewed in NodemailerApp, which catches email messages for testing needs without the need of providing them to actual recipients. You can also retrieve these e-mail by way of POP3 if wanted.

should you’d like to keep getting e-mails into Mailtrap AND produce them to recipients, you may use one among our top quality features referred to as electronic mail for every Inbox.

auth.xoauth2 will be the OAuth2 access token (chosen if both go and xoauth2 values are established) or an XOAuth2 token generator item.

In OSX, XAMPP operates your Internet application within an isolated container, creating immediate sendmail requests to NodemailerApp impossible. alternatively, use the Linux Variation of sendmail replacement to proxy e-mail around SMTP, which requires that NodemailerApp is functioning.

Gmail both functions effectively, or it doesn't function in the slightest degree. It is most likely much easier to swap to an node js expert alternate service in place of fixing difficulties with Gmail. If Gmail doesn't give you the results you want, then don't utilize it. browse more details on it here.

is fake then Nodemailer attempts to use STARTTLS although the server won't market assistance for it. Should the connection cannot be encrypted then message is not really despatched

If authentication data is not present, the link is taken into account authenticated from the beginning. established authentication facts with possibilities.auth

In the decide on application dropdown, select your application or enter a custom identify, then do the same with the Select machine dropdown

choice to real to implement it. a hard and fast level of pooled connections are utilized to send out messages. handy When you've got a large number of messages that you might want to mail in batches.

If authentication knowledge is not really existing, the relationship is considered authenticated from the beginning. Otherwise you would wish to provide the authentication options item.

For anyone who is functioning the code on your own machine, Test your antivirus options. Antiviruses typically mess all around with e-mail ports usage. Node.js may not acknowledge the MITM cert your antivirus is using.

I have supplied a url to your job on GitHub. listed here you will discover every one of the code snippets employed for this challenge.

or being an deal with item (In such cases you do not need to bother with the formatting, no must use rates and many others.)

Leave a Reply

Your email address will not be published. Required fields are marked *